The Challenge

Healthcare finance leaders operate at two levels. At the strategic level, they need to understand overall margin performance, cost drivers, and revenue trends across the organization.  At the operational level, they rely on RCM analytics to track claims, billing workflows, and denial resolution. But most available tools serve only the tactical layer, answering narrow questions: Was this claim paid? Where’s the denial?

What these tools can’t do is let leaders explore financial data independently: test hypotheses, drill into cost drivers, or connect financial performance to clinical and operational reality.

  • Healthcare cost analytics stays siloed.
  • Revenue analysis can’t be explored alongside patient acuity or care patterns.
  • Every strategic question requires analyst support.

Outcomes of Kodjin’s Healthcare Financial Analytics

Strategic Visibility into the Margin Driver

According to Kaufman Hall/Fierce Healthcare, the median hospital operating margin was 1.3% for full-year 2025. While margins were stronger than in the immediate post-pandemic period, hospitals continue to face headwinds from rising costs, eroding payer mix, and growing bad debt, leaving little room for strategic missteps.

Kodjin helps finance leaders understand exactly where margin is being made or lost by service line, payer, provider, and patient population. By connecting cost data to clinical context, organizations can identify which operational decisions are driving financial results and which are quietly eroding them.

Organization-level impact:

Sharper financial planning, evidence-based resource allocation, and strategic decisions grounded in cross-domain data.

Reduced Revenue Leakage and Denial Exposure

AHA estimates that hospitals spent $43 billion in 2025 trying to collect payments insurers owe for care already delivered. Denial management alone costs $18 billion, with prior authorization, documentation requests, and appeals pulling resources away from patient care.

Kodjin helps organizations see denial patterns in clinical context, connecting denial reasons to documentation gaps, coding variation, and payer-specific behavior. Instead of chasing individual claims, teams can fix the upstream issues that cause revenue leakage in the first place.

Organization-level impact:

Lower denial rates, faster collections, and reduced administrative costs of revenue recovery.

Better Cost Control Through Clinical-Financial Alignment

A recent AHA/Vizient analysis found that 36% of hospital cost growth came from treating more patients, 19% from higher patient acuity, and 45% from rising per-patient costs, including labor, supplies, and drugs.

Kodjin helps organizations untangle these cost drivers. Finance and clinical teams can analyze cost variation by episode, provider, and treatment pathway, seeing where spending is clinically justified and where it reflects inefficiency. This turns healthcare cost management from a back-office function into a shared strategic conversation.

Organization-level impact:

Targeted cost reduction, stronger clinical-financial alignment, and the ability to distinguish necessary spending from waste.

Stronger Positioning in Value-Based Contracts

According to the Advisory Board, margin pressure in 2026 is more intense than at any point in the last decade. With payers tightening rate negotiations, hospitals can no longer offset rising costs through higher commercial allowable rates alone.

Kodjin helps organizations connect population health performance to financial outcomes, tracking shared savings, modeling risk exposure, and monitoring cost-per-member trends across value-based arrangements. Leaders can see how quality metrics and care pathway decisions affect total cost of care, identify high-risk cohorts driving spend, and evaluate whether VBC contracts are performing as modeled.

Organization-level impact:

Stronger contract negotiations, better risk forecasting, clearer visibility into total cost of care, and tighter alignment between clinical quality and financial sustainability.

Why Healthcare Financial Analytics Needs Cross-Domain Data

Traditional financial tools work with billing and claims data in isolation. But the questions that matter most – “Why are costs rising in this service line?”, “Is this payer contract actually profitable?”, “Where is clinical variation driving unnecessary spend?” – requires connecting financial data to the clinical and operational context. That’s what Kodjin’s semantic layer does.

FAQ

How to choose a healthcare finance analytics solution?

The first question to ask is whether the tool you’re evaluating is really a healthcare finance analytics solution or just RCM reporting with a nicer interface. A true healthcare financial analytics software should let you connect financial data to clinical and operational context, so you can answer strategic questions. Look for cross-domain data unification, natural language querying, and the flexibility to explore cost, revenue, and utilization across service lines, providers, and payer contracts. Kodjin delivers all of this on a FHIR-native, healthcare cost management foundation.

Is the Kodjin platform an affordable solution for midsize hospitals?

Yes. Kodjin is modular by design, so you assemble only the components you need for your specific use case. A midsize hospital focused on healthcare cost analytics and service line profitability doesn’t need to buy the same configuration as a large health system running a full financial planning & data analytics platform. That modularity keeps costs proportional to scope, and the platform’s low-code operational tools reduce ongoing maintenance overhead compared to traditional financial data management solutions.

How can your healthcare finance analytics solution cut denials?

Most denial management tools work at the claim level, flagging individual denials after they happen. Kodjin takes a different approach. As a healthcare cost analytics software, it connects denial patterns to clinical documentation quality, coding variation, and payer-specific behavior. When you can see that a particular procedure has a high denial rate tied to specific documentation gaps, you can fix the root cause rather than chasing each denial individually. This is the difference between a cost analysis tool and a strategic healthcare finance solutions platform.

Does Kodjin cost management solution help reduce bad debt and write-offs?

It does by helping organizations understand the upstream causes. Kodjin’s medical cost analysis capabilities connect write-off patterns to patient demographics, payer behavior, service types, and clinical context. This helps finance teams identify which patient populations or services are driving bad debt and develop targeted strategies, whether that’s better upfront financial counseling, adjusted payment plans, or payer contract renegotiation. It’s a more strategic approach to healthcare cost management than simply tracking write-offs after the fact.

How does real-time analytics improve financial decision-making?

When financial data is weeks or months old, leaders are reacting to problems instead of preventing them. Kodjin’s financial data analytics software supports near-real-time data ingestion, so finance teams can monitor margin trends, revenue analysis, and cost performance as they develop. This is especially critical for financial data management solutions in organizations managing value-based contracts, where timely insight into cost-per-member and utilization trends directly affects financial performance.

Can this solution support value-based care models?

Absolutely, and this is one of the areas where Kodjin’s cross-domain approach matters most. Value-based care requires understanding how clinical performance connects to financial outcomes. Kodjin brings population health data, utilization patterns, quality measures, and cost data into a single healthcare financial analytics layer. That means leaders can track shared savings, model risk exposure, and analyze cost-per-member trends alongside clinical quality, all in one place. It works as both a cost analysis tool and a strategic healthcare finance analytics solution for organizations moving toward risk-based payment models.
